gardūn[gard, q.v.+ūn= wan= wān= Zend vant= S. वन्त् (nom. वान् )], s.m. A wheel; the heavens, the firmament, the celestial globe or sphere; chance, fortune (and her revolving wheel);—an engine (for pulling up trees by the roots, etc.), a windlass;—a chariot, chaise; a child's go-cart (by which he learns to walk).
Origin: Persian
